Translation guide
In Japanese, 'cosmetic surgery' is most commonly expressed as 美容整形 (biyō seikei), which refers to elective procedures to improve appearance. A more formal medical term is 形成外科 (keisei geka), but this often includes reconstructive surgery. For everyday conversation, 整形 (seikei) alone is widely understood. Be aware that 美容外科 (biyō geka) is also used, especially in clinic names.
The most common meaning: surgical procedures done for aesthetic reasons, not medical necessity.
Surgery to repair or reconstruct body parts, often after injury or illness. This is a broader medical term that includes cosmetic procedures but also medically necessary ones.
美容整形 (biyō seikei) is specifically for aesthetic improvement, while 形成外科 (keisei geka) is the broader medical field of plastic surgery, which includes reconstructive procedures. In everyday conversation, 整形 (seikei) almost always means cosmetic surgery.
美容整形は自費だが、形成外科は保険がきくこともある。
Cosmetic surgery is out-of-pocket, but plastic surgery may be covered by insurance.
整形 (seikei) alone can mean 'orthopedics' in medical contexts. However, in casual conversation, it almost always refers to cosmetic surgery. Context usually makes it clear.
The standard term for cosmetic surgery. Widely understood and used in both formal and informal contexts.
彼女は美容整形を受けた。
She had cosmetic surgery.
美容整形に興味がありますか?
Are you interested in cosmetic surgery?
Short for 美容整形. Very common in casual speech. Can also refer to orthopedics in medical contexts, but in everyday use it usually means cosmetic surgery.
Literally 'aesthetic surgery'. Often used in clinic names and formal contexts. Slightly more technical than 美容整形.
あの美容外科は評判がいい。
That cosmetic surgery clinic has a good reputation.
The formal medical term for plastic/reconstructive surgery. Covers both cosmetic and reconstructive procedures. Used in hospital departments.
形成外科で手術を受けた。
I had surgery in the plastic surgery department.
Specifically refers to reconstructive surgery, such as breast reconstruction after mastectomy. More technical and less common in everyday language.
再建外科は保険が適用される場合がある。
Reconstructive surgery may be covered by insurance.
